Eduardo de Souza Martins Fernandes
Silvestre Adventist Hospital
Country: Brazil
Biography:
Dr. Eduardo de Souza Martins Fernandes, is an esteemed Brazilian surgeon specializing in hepatobiliary surgery, liver transplantation, and abdominal surgical oncology. With a robust educational background, he earned his medical degree from the Faculdade de Medicina de Teresópolis (FESO) in 2001. He then completed his general surgery residency at Rio de Janeiro Adventist Hospital, followed by specialized training in hepatobiliary surgery and transplantation at prestigious institutions such as the Federal University of Rio de Janeiro, the University of Nebraska Medical Center, and Chang Gung Memorial Hospital in Taiwan. Dr. Fernandes further advanced his expertise with a PhD from the Rio de Janeiro State University, focusing on liver transplant techniques.
Currently, Dr. Fernandes holds several key positions. He is the Chief of General Surgery and Transplantation at Rio de Janeiro Adventist Hospital, the Surgical Director of the Liver Transplant Program at DHR Health Transplant Institute in McAllen, Texas, and an Assistant Professor of Surgery at both Rio de Janeiro Federal University and DHR Health. Additionally, he serves as a visiting professor at the Pontifical Catholic University of Chile and Surgical Director at Hospital São Francisco de Assis and Hospital São Lucas, both in Rio de Janeiro. Dr. Fernandes has made significant contributions to international medical conferences, delivering lectures on complex liver resections, transplantation, and pancreatic cancer surgery. He is a respected member of several global surgical societies, including the International Hepatopancreatobiliary Association and the American Hepatopancreatobiliary Association.
Dr. Fernandes' dedication to advancing surgical techniques and improving patient outcomes in transplant and oncology surgery is reflected in his extensive training, leadership roles, and continued participation in international medical education and research.
